Inside the titles folder, create a new folder with the exact Title ID you found in Step 2. For our example, you would create SD:/luma/titles/000400000012A100/ . Now, open the folder repack you downloaded. It will most likely contain a folder named romfs , and sometimes an exefs or code.bin .
